Attendees from 93 countries visited the booths of a record 988 exhibitors (including 231 first-timers), showing the latest developments in display, projection, audio, collaborative conferencing, control and networking applications. Exhibits and special events occupied more than 500,000sq ft (net) of space, compared with 465,000sq ft in 2007.

“InfoComm 08 reflects the fast pace of innovations and growth in the AV communications industry,” said Randal Lemke, InfoComm International executive director. “We introduced new courses and exhibitors this year to address the demand for digital signage, audio, and telepresence technology, as well as high-definition products, lighting and staging, and more.”

InfoComm’s educational sessions also proved popular. For instance, Super Tuesday, a full day of advanced courses for AV professionals, drew 817 registrants – a 12% increase over 2007.
